Friendship Lunch to be held in Oakham on Monday

By The Editor 23rd Jul 2021

A leading Rutland care provider is hosting a Friendship Lunch in Oakham on Monday.

Home Instead is hosting the event at the Rutland Garden Village Cafe from 12 noon until 2.30pm.

The Friendship Lunch is held on the fourth Monday of every month.

Home Instead managing director Gail Devereux-Batchelor said: "So pleased to be out and about with our clients, and we are hosting our Friendship Lunch at the lovely Rutland Garden Village Café, on Ashwell Road.

"Lunch is £10 for a two course meal or £12.50 for a two course meal and a drink."

The Friendship Lunch also promises a good company, charity raffle and a quiz.
